Transaction 7d9153d2ed874b40f7f8b39dcdfe832574b6818aac4c5d7418ecfd5f68b49501

43 Input
2 Outputs
  • 7d9153d2ed874b40f7f8b39dcdfe832574b6818aac4c5d7418ecfd5f68b49501:0
  • value  2040342
    address  3KBWTeyheoR88JonmpKiXDeraSvQq6hNsb
  • 7d9153d2ed874b40f7f8b39dcdfe832574b6818aac4c5d7418ecfd5f68b49501:1
  • value  255000000
    address  1BMEaTS5tMC9bRVbt4FD5T4soMH4Xa6SBp